Pak Choi Bok Choy Seeds 🥬🌱

Pak Choi Bok Choy Seeds produce compact, leafy green plants with crisp white stems and tender green leaves. These plants grow quickly and are perfect for adding fresh greens to your dishes. Bok Choy is known for its mild flavor and crunchy texture, making it an excellent choice for stir-fries, salads, and soups. This variety is easy to grow and ideal for both home gardens and container gardening.

About This Item 🌿

  • Type of Seeds: Non-Hybrid, Open Pollinated, and Non-GMO
  • Germination Time: 5-7 days
  • Hours of Sunlight: Needs 4-6 hours of sunlight daily
  • Where to Grow: Suitable for gardens, kitchen gardens, or large pots
  • Growing Season: Best sown in early spring or late summer
  • Seeds Sowing Depth: 1/4 inch deep
  • Ideal Climate: Cool to mild weather
  • Plant Height: Grows up to 12-18 inches tall
  • Organic Fertilizer Requirement: Use balanced organic fertilizer every 2-3 weeks
  • Life Span: Annual plant (grows and produces in one season)
  • Ideal Growing Temperature: 15-25°C
  • Harvesting Time: Ready to harvest in 40-50 days
  • Maintenance Required: Low; requires regular watering
  • Watering Frequency: Keep the soil consistently moist
  • Ideal Grow Bag Size: Use a 12-15 inch grow bag for best growth

Growing Season in India 🇮🇳🌞

In India, Pak Choi Bok Choy Seeds are best sown during the cool months of early spring and late summer. These plants thrive in loose, well-draining soil and produce high-quality greens in mild weather.

How to Grow in Pots 🪴

  1. Choose a Pot: Use a pot that is at least 12-15 inches wide and deep.
  2. Soil Preparation: Fill the pot with loose, well-draining soil mixed with compost.
  3. Sowing Depth: Plant the seeds 1/4 inch deep in the soil.
  4. Sunlight: Place the pot in a semi-shaded spot that receives 4-6 hours of sunlight daily.
  5. Watering: Keep the soil moist but avoid waterlogging.
  6. Spacing: Space the plants 6-8 inches apart for optimal growth.

Seeds Sowing Method 🌾

  • Preparation: Use loose, nutrient-rich soil for best results.
  • Sowing: Plant seeds 1/4 inch deep and space them 6-8 inches apart.
  • Watering: Water gently to maintain even moisture.
  • Germination: Seeds will sprout in 5-7 days under cool conditions.
  • Transplanting: Transplant seedlings when they are 4-6 inches tall with 2-3 true leaves.

Plant Care Tips 🍀

  • Sunlight: Needs 4-6 hours of sunlight daily.
  • Soil: Use nutrient-rich, well-draining soil.
  • Fertilization: Apply balanced organic fertilizer every 2-3 weeks.
  • Pruning: Remove yellow or damaged leaves to keep the plant healthy.
  • Support and Spacing: Space the plants properly to allow good airflow.
  • Pest Control: Check for common pests like aphids and treat promptly.
  • Disease Prevention: Ensure good airflow and avoid over-watering.

Special Features 🌟

Pak Choi Bok Choy produces crunchy, tender stalks with mild, sweet leaves. The plants are quick-growing and easy to maintain, making them perfect for beginner gardeners. Bok Choy is rich in vitamins A, C, and K, making it a healthy addition to any meal.

Benefits/Uses 🍽️

Bok Choy is perfect for stir-fries, soups, and salads. It is low in calories and rich in essential nutrients, making it ideal for healthy eating. The mild flavor pairs well with various dishes, adding a fresh crunch to your meals.

Precautions While Growing ⚠️

When growing Pak Choi Bok Choy Seeds, ensure the soil is loose and well-draining. Water regularly to keep the soil moist but avoid waterlogging. Monitor for pests and diseases to keep the plants healthy.

Common Problems Affecting Plants and Solutions 🐛❗

Common issues include pests like aphids and diseases like downy mildew. To prevent these problems, ensure good airflow and use organic pest control methods. Remove affected leaves to avoid disease spread.
